AMResorts Is Planning Another All-Inclusive Expansion

By: Caribbean Journal Staff - April 10, 2019

By Alexander Britell

Apple Leisure Group’s surging AMResorts brand is planning another major all-inclusive expansion in the greater Caribbean.

The company is set to open five new all-inclusive hotels in 2019 under the Dreams, Now and Sunscape brands.

Two of those resorts will open in June: the all-inclusive Now Emerald Cancun Resort and Spa, which will feature 427 rooms on a site just eight minutes from Cancun’s airport; and the Sunscape Akumal Beach Resort and Spa, which will feature 360 rooms in the up-and-coming destination of Akumal near Tulum.

In November, AMResorts will debut the Sunscape Star Cancun Resort and Spa adjacent to the Punta Cancun Golf Club.

In December, the company will debut the Now Natura Riviera Cancun, a 556-room resort featuring a water park.

That’s topped off by the planned late 2019 opening of the Dreams Acapulco Resort and Spa, a 605-room resort on Playa Icacos on Acapulco’s Miguel Aleman coast.

“Mexico continues to offer an abundance of investment possibilities for resort owners, given its variety of destinations catering to every type of traveler,” said Javier Coll, Executive Vice President and Chief Strategy Officer of Apple Leisure Group. “With our growing footprint in Mexico, and access to the largest distribution network selling all-inclusive vacations in Mexico, we offer an incomparable value proposition for investors. As one of the leading leisure hospitality companies in the country, AMResorts will have over 60 branded resorts with more 24,000 rooms across Mexico, the Caribbean, Central America and Europe at the close of this year and will continue to enter new and emerging destinations further expanding its brand presence globally.”

The company also announced it would be streamlining the branding of its newest brand, Reflect, changing the names of three resorts in Mexico to Reflect Cancun Resort and Spa, Reflect Los Cabos Resort and Spa and Reflect Nuevo Vallarta Resort and Spa.

“Despite the challenges present in the market, expansion throughout Mexico remains one of our major priorities,” said Alex Zozaya, CEO of Apple Leisure Group. “We remain bullish on the county’s long-term potential and are committed to working closely with local officials to help Mexico reach its full potential. We look forward to further expanding AMResorts’ brand presence in the country, with more opportunities to come.”

AMResorts is also planning other properties in wider region, with the highly-anticipated Secrets St Martin set to open in March 2020, while a pair of Breathless-branded resorts will open in 2020 and 2021 in Cancun and Tulum, respectively.

“We are thrilled to continue our growth efforts in a country filled with culturally rich destinations and diverse tourism offerings,” said Gonzalo del Peon, AMResorts President. “Mexico remains a priority market for AMResorts as we continue to raise the bar to meet travelers’ expectations.”
